In a multi-threaded computing environment, a shared cache system reduces the amount of redundant information stored in memory. A cache memory area provides both global readable data and private writable data to processing threads. A particular processing thread accesses data by first checking its private views of modified data and then its global views of read-only data. Uncached data is read into a cache buffer for global access. If write access is required by the processing thread, the data is copied into a new cache buffer, which is assigned to the processing thread's private view. The particular shared cache system supports generational views of data. The system is particularly useful in on-line analytical processing of multi-dimensional databases.

В мулти-prodetuh нитку вычисляя окружающую среду, котор делят система тайника уменьшает количество избыточнаяа информация, котор хранят в памяти. Зона сверхоперативной памяти снабубежит и гловальные четкие данные и приватные writable данные обрабатывать резьбы. Частность обрабатывая резьбу достигает данных сперва проверять свои приватные взгляды доработанных данных и после этого свои гловальные взгляды данных только для чтения. Данные по Uncached прочитаны в буфер тайника для гловального доступа. Если напишите, то доступ необходим обрабатывая резьбой, данные скопирован в новый буфер тайника, который задан к взгляду обрабатывая резьбы приватному. Определенная, котор делят система тайника поддерживает взгляды generational данных. Система определенно полезна в on-line аналитическаяа обработка многомерных баз данных.

 
Web www.patentalert.com

< (none)

< Method and apparatus for producing sequenced queries

> Cool ice state management

> (none)

~ 00021